Emphasizing a practical approach, Design and Modeling for Computer Experiments provides useful techniques for statisticians, engineers, and scientists to apply the methodologies presented. The book introduces basic concepts of design as well as the concept of Latin hypercube sampling and its modifications. It covers uniform design, measures of uniformity, and their algebraic equations and provides various stochastic optimization techniques along with popular algorithms such as simulated annealing, stochastic evolutionary, and threshold acceptance. The text also discusses special techniques for model interpretation, including generalized ANOVA and the Fourier Amplitude Sensitivity Test.
